From 4a44003bb59fb1a1e82f1b5598bf0b8cf33962e1 Mon Sep 17 00:00:00 2001 From: Eduardo Chiarotti Date: Thu, 4 Jul 2024 21:56:41 -0300 Subject: [PATCH] fix: test changing prompt tokens to get error on CI --- .../agents/agent_builder/utilities/base_token_process.py | 4 ++-- src/crewai/crew.py | 6 +++---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/src/crewai/agents/agent_builder/utilities/base_token_process.py b/src/crewai/agents/agent_builder/utilities/base_token_process.py index ce0b446d3..6144f0ef6 100644 --- a/src/crewai/agents/agent_builder/utilities/base_token_process.py +++ b/src/crewai/agents/agent_builder/utilities/base_token_process.py @@ -8,7 +8,7 @@ class TokenProcess: successful_requests: int = 0 def sum_prompt_tokens(self, tokens: int): - self.prompt_tokens = self.prompt_tokens + tokens + self.prompt_tokens = 42 self.total_tokens = self.total_tokens + tokens def sum_completion_tokens(self, tokens: int): @@ -21,7 +21,7 @@ class TokenProcess: def get_summary(self) -> Dict[str, Any]: return { "total_tokens": self.total_tokens, - "prompt_tokens": self.prompt_tokens, + "prompt_tokens": 23, "completion_tokens": self.completion_tokens, "successful_requests": self.successful_requests, } diff --git a/src/crewai/crew.py b/src/crewai/crew.py index 25e1fe096..0169ea344 100644 --- a/src/crewai/crew.py +++ b/src/crewai/crew.py @@ -369,7 +369,7 @@ class Crew(BaseModel): # Initialize the parent crew's usage metrics total_usage_metrics = { "total_tokens": 0, - "prompt_tokens": 0, + "prompt_tokens": 5, "completion_tokens": 0, "successful_requests": 0, } @@ -409,7 +409,7 @@ class Crew(BaseModel): total_usage_metrics = { "total_tokens": 0, - "prompt_tokens": 0, + "prompt_tokens": 10, "completion_tokens": 0, "successful_requests": 0, } @@ -597,7 +597,7 @@ class Crew(BaseModel): """Calculates and returns the usage metrics.""" total_usage_metrics = { "total_tokens": 0, - "prompt_tokens": 0, + "prompt_tokens": 15, "completion_tokens": 0, "successful_requests": 0, }